Overview

The Devoted Few, stalwarts of Sydney’ music scene, complete with the unmistakable flame red hair of Ben Fletcher, are teaming up with Sherlock’s Daughter on a east coast tour of ‘Straya.

Not so long ago The Devoted Few released their third album Baby You’re A Vampire, following up from their very well received Schematic Track. Baby You’re a Vampire was mixed by Jacquire King (Modest Mouse, Kings Of Leon) in Nashville USA, a big pop album full of melodic rock, sometimes derivative of Arcade Fire (see the acoustic guitar driven Frosty Furnaces with it’s rolling drums straight out of No Cars Go), but The DF do put on a good live show with a large group of gifted musicians.

The buzziest of buzz bands at the moment, Sherlock’s Daughter just released their debut EP, produced by Jono Ma from Lost Valentinos. Sherlocks’ deserve the hype, as they are ignoring the status quo that has been prevalent in a lot of Aus music of late; instead playing droney, energetic and impassioned rock, sometimes trancing out live for 10 minutes at a time â€" territory that many bands would fear. They have been the golden children of Sydney lately, supporting School Of Seven Bells, playing Laneway Festival and generally whipping up hype like meringue.

The bands are playing two nights at the much loved Surry Hills watering hole The Hopetoun, so try to make it to one of them, or both if you are rabid.
